About 21 Arlington Crescent
21 Arlington Crescent is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in East Preston, Littlehampton, Littlehampton (BN16 1DL). It has a recorded floor area of 68 m² (around 732 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(April 2013) shows a C (score 72). The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 92),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from April 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Across 1995–2013, sale prices on this property compounded at 8.3%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£306,000 sits 67.2% above the 2013 sale of £183,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£250/sq ft) was about 28.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sold in June 2013, so it's been off the market for around 13 years. At 68 m² it's 20.9%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(86 m² median across 13 EPCs).
